Place the ohmmeter on The 2 slip rings on the alternator shaft (exactly where the brushes Call). There should be Virtually no resistance. Place a single direct over the slip ring and one particular around the alternator shaft. There needs to be infinite resistance.

That currently being claimed, new alternators also tend to come with that brand-new cost, that's where you can undoubtedly earn which has a refurbished alternator. To be honest, a refurbished alternator is actually just a fancy time period for one which has been rebuilt and designed shiny yet again. It's had the vast majority of its innards exchanged for brand-new parts and it is just about a fresh alternator with the aged casing.
